Launched in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been devoted to reducing the time to market for innovators crafting new medical devices. The company specializes by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times of approximately 1 to 3 days—an achievement impractical with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ard realized the critical need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for highly active development programs developing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is paramount in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old great value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
Moreover rout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Collaborating with Blue Line enables developers of new medical devices to notably shorten their schedules, promptly assess new design iterations, and expedite product launches.

The Necessity of Medical Device Sterilization
Controlling infections remains a mainstay of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Effective sterilization of medical devices drastically re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ers simultaneously. Deficient sterilization can result in outbreaks of major di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Procedures for Medical Device Sterilization
The science behind sterilization has progressed substantially over the last century, using a variety of methods suited to diverse types of devices and materials. Some of the most predominantly chosen techniques include:
Sterilization Using Autoclaves
Autoclaving remains the most prevalent and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is efficient, reasonably priced, and eco-friendly,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Intricate Materials and Device Complexity
The rise of innovative med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ization methods capable of handling intricate materials. Advancements in sterilization include methods namely low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ging delicate components.
Digital Traceability and Verification
With advances in digital technology, tracking of sterilization operations is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er exhaustive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time updates, significantly limiting human error and strengthening patient safety.
